Abstract

Radiographic images of post-gastrectomy and after the cyst removal in dental bone loss registered within 1 year period. Images of 28 patients (8 images directly after the procedure and 20 images after 12 months) who underwent the Guided Bone Regeneration surgery. The X-rays were obtained using Kodak RVG 6100 set with a resolution higher than 14 pl/mm. Textural analysis of these areas included: cropping rectangular ROIs (Regions of Interest) from both types of images (right after and ‘1 year after’ the procedure), computing following features: 3 basic (minimum, maximum, average value of pixels), GLRL matrix and GLCM. The final step was the assessment of the features and analysis of those which are statistically significant.
